he's nearly 50, been ko'd 16 times, been fighting pro for 27 years, and shown awful punch resistance and ability to defend himself. prime was almost 20 years ago. doesn't annoy me that ppl don't think he should fight anymore.

most journeymen are much younger, have taken much less punishment, and defend themselves better. those who are as old, shot, and easy to hurt and hit as danny should retire too

I feel sorry for him because he would probably struggle to start a new career now, he is 48 years old and only knows boxing. I also wonder how damaged he is, almost 90 pro fights at HW when you are years past your best won't be good for his health. His last fight in the UK was in 2010 so there must be a reason he is fighting abroad now, maybe he knows he wouldn't pass a medical in the UK. Everyone needs money and unfortunately he doesn't appear to have many options.
